This secretary desk is curved on the sides and front.
It opens with a drawer featuring an inverted cyma molding, two doors, and a drop-front without a crossbar.
It is inlaid with rosewood in a herringbone pattern, cartouches, and framed in amaranth.
Inside, it reveals two curved drawers and two rosewood shelves.
This secretary desk is distinguished by the purity of its craftsmanship and the rarity of the absence of a crossbar between the two doors and the drop-front.
The top is made of breccia marble with a molded edge.
A Louis XV period piece, stamped L. BOUDIN and JME Léonard Boudin (1735-November 20, 1807), who became a master craftsman on March 4, 1761.
Dimensions: 143 cm H x 90 cm W x 37 cm D
